Health & Travel Insurance for German Visa application and Studies

 It is mandatory for every one to get compulsory heath insurance during stay of Germany and travel insurance when intend to travel to Germany for any purpose.  Travel insurance (one you need during visa application) and health insurance (which you buy after reaching in Germany).This article covers details of getting health  and travel insurance. 

1-Travel insurance: Required by embassy/consulate as mandatory visa application document. The insurance should be valid for 1 to 3 months, around the dates in which you intend to fly . It should provide a cover of 30,000 Euros. Most of time the difference between travel insurance of 1 month and 3 month is very less, so I recommend you to buy 3 months travel insurance. It gives you some edge to plan the intended travel dates. Generally it costs around 6000 to 7000 PKRS.


Mostly travel insurance covers your air trip and couple of week period after you acquire health insurance in Germany.

2-Health insurance: It is compulsory for every citizen and animal in Germany to acquire health insurance. You will not get enrollment in university or any legal status in Auslanderbehorde without acquiring valid health insurance. Generally there are public sector and private sector health insurance options in Germany. The following section will help to understand between both types.

Public vs Private Insurance
There are two types of Insurances in Germany:  Public health insurance like TK or AOK & private ones like mawista & many others. Following are differences between both: 

Payment Method:
The public Health insurance has wide acceptability in term of doctor panels throughout Germany. Mostly they have cards through which  fee of the doctor is directly paid . While in the case of Private health insurance you have to pay first & then the bills are reimbursed. Also you can visit the selected doctors as recommended by the private health insurance. 

Insurance cover & Monthly Beitrag:
Besides this fact there is difference between possible cover of insurance. Public health insurance covers spectra more broad than the private one.
  The disadvantage of public insurance is that it is expensive. normally it is around 80 Euros if you are less then age of 30 & 150 euros if you are more elder. The private health Insurances are cheap , typical cost is between 28 euros to 35 euros per month. 


However this is just introductory cost after one year this cost will be increased & you have to switch your insurance to another private company. But you can get the same introductory cost if you resign the contract with the insurance company.

Leaving Insurance:
Once you acquire the public Health insurance and you leave public health insurance you can't switch back to public till you change your VISA status. However visaversa is possible. So if you start with public health insurance , think well before leaving it. 

Acceptance of Insurance:
Sometimes there are issues of acceptance of insurance in AAA of your university. TK & AOK are accepted by every university, some selected brands of private insurance may not be accepted by your AAA. For further information please visit the insurance policies of particular companies.

Single versus Married Prospect:
Public Health Insurance automatically covers your whole family. It does not matter if you are single or with family you have to pay same for Public Health insurance while in Private health insurance the cover is for single person & for family you need separate policy.

Summary
If you are single and intend to remain single while living in Germany and on top of that if you rarely visit a doctor then private insurance is a cheaper option. But as mentioned above you have to pay doctors personally before getting refund from insurance company. These payments can be quite high so be prepared to have lot of money available on demand in your account for the situation when you get severely ill or other expensive treatment like with dentists. Public insurance is good if you frequently visit doctor or if you intend to keep your family in Germany. Public insurance cover your whole family while private covers individuals. Last but not least advice, never save on the risk of health & safety.
